Motor sports on Phillip Island
Phillip Island picks up the pace when the motorcycle racing fraternity journeys south. The island is home to the World Superbike Championship held in April and the Australian Motorcycle Grand Prix held in October. Four-wheel enthusiasts can get their fix when the V8 Supercar Championship roars into town during November.

Phillip Island Circuit With a history of action on the track dating back to 1928, the Phillip Island Circuit offers visitors the chance to re-acquaint themselves with all aspects of motor racing, as well as get a glimpse of life on the island in times gone by.
The History of Motor Sport depicts different eras of motor racing through to the present day, with photos and vehicles on display. You can also tour the race control tower, podium and the pits to see where all the action happens
Take a walk through the circuit’s adjoining water gardens up to the circuit viewing area, which offers panoramic views of the track set against the backdrop of the ocean.
HSV Hotlaps, a new activity at the track offers you the chance to strap yourself in for three laps around the Phillip Island Circuit with a professional racing car driver.
